Overview

Located in the town of Ferndale, Guthrie Creek Beach is a long, wide, and rarely-visited beach that is backed by headlands and cliffs – and is situated at the mouth of Guthrie Creek. Also known as Lost Coast Headlands, Guthrie Creek Beach was added to California Coastal National Monument by President Barack Obama in 2016. Guthrie Creek Beach is a dog-friendly beach and offers many amenities including restrooms, driftwoods, hiking trails, and fossils. There are a couple of fun activities at Guthrie Creek Beach including hiking, birdwatching, and beachcombing. To access Guthrie Creek Beach, drive down to 8028 Centerville Road where you will find a free parking lot near Guthrie Creek Trailhead. After parking, you will need to walk 15 minutes along the trail to reach the beach. Please note that the Bureau of Land Management has labeled the last section of the trail as unstable so be careful towards the end.

Activities

If you are looking for attractions near Guthrie Creek Beach, you can drive 40 minutes to the non-profit children’s museum Redwood Discovery Museum featuring many interactive exhibitions and thematic education programs in the fields of science, art, culture, technology, and healthy living. Another great museum near Guthrie Creek Beach is Phillips House Museum which offers many historical exhibits, photographs, and antiques from the city of Arcata. Spread across 793 acres, Arcata Community Forest is home to an expansive trail network for mountain biking, hiking, and dog walking, incredible redwood trees, and many animals including deer, grizzly bears, black bears, cougars, and wolves. Another great attraction near Guthrie Creek Beach is Immortal Tree, a 1,000 years old Coastal redwood tree that is 258 feet tall and has survived the Flood of 1964, lightning, and fire – it is a fantastic place for Instagram-worthy pictures and picnicking.

Restaurants

If you get hungry, there are many restaurants within a 30-minute drive of Guthrie Creek Beach. Ferndale Pizza Co. serves excellent thin-crust pizzas, homemade pasta, and vegan items. Double D Steak & Seafood features seafood items, chips, bacon, sandwiches, beer, and picnic tables. Another good restaurant near Guthrie Creek Beach is Hot Deli which offers burgers, hot dogs, steaks, pastrami, wings, salads, French fries, and shakes.

Hotels

If you are looking for a hotel near Guthrie Creek Beach, you can drive 18 minutes to many nearby hotels. The historic 4-Star hotel Gingerbread Mansion Inn features a wine cellar and spa. Victorian Inn is a 3-Star hotel that is located in a Victorian-era village and offers a lounge and restaurant. If you are looking for a budget-friendly hotel near Guthrie Creek Beach, the 2-Star Scandinavian-style hotel Ye Olde Danish Inn has a pool table.
